Hanuman continues to be a determine of veneration and admiration, inspiring tens of millions to strive for bravery in adversity and unyielding devotion inside their spiritual pursuits. Picture: A monument of Hanuman in the Indian state of Andhra Pradesh. , carries on to get recited now by thousands of people https://www.instagram.com/p/DN3HgEiZkKK/